UMMN_Mitridatizzazione is the third phase of the projectUna Maestosa Macchina Narrativa, where media, artists, and musicians come together to explore the potential of constructing visual imaginaries as a tool for knowledge. Through the interplay of painting, sound, image, and performance, the research examines storytelling as a practice capable of fostering shared experiences and awareness.
The project is structured as a research dispositive and in 2026 the journey begins with Nuovo Muralismo, a collective workshop on mural painting and engagement with public space, carried out with high school students from Cobianchi, Cavalieri, and Ferrini-Franzosini as part of “CROSS Action!”.
This is followed by a residency phase combining studio work and natural settings in the VCO region, culminating in a presentation in the form of a performative, sound, and visual installation at the Atelier di Casa Ceretti. The new iteration of the project is a multi-channel video work created with the support of The Solo House and director Marco Proserpio, featuring live sound by 2501 and Nunzio Cicero.

Jacopo Ceccarelli aka 2501 is a multidisciplinary artist who works across painting, mural art, installation, writing, and film. He is fascinated by maps, architecture, and the social contradictions of urban spaces. For years, he has been exploring circular flow, recurrences, and other temporal forms. His murals can be seen around the world; over the past twenty years, he has exhibited in Europe, the U.S., and South America at galleries and museums. He participates in various international exhibitions and festivals such as the Luigi Pecci Center for Contemporary Art, the Milan Triennale, MACRO in Rome, and Basel Miami at Product / 81 Creative Lab; as well as public art festivals including O.BRA, Living Walls, ALTrove, Artmossphere Biennale, Walk& Talk, Wabash Arts Corridor, Outdoor, Mural, and the Painted Desert Project.
